Shivpurwa - Churhat, Sidhi

Shivpurwa is a village situated in the Churhat tehsil of Sidhi district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 18 km from the tehsil headquarters in Churhat and around 25 km from the district headquarters in Sidhi. Shivpurwa village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Shivpurwa is 502491. The village covers a total geographical area of 172.77 hectares and falls under the 486661 pincode. Churhat is the nearest town, located about 18 km away.

Shivpurwa village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Churhat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Sidhi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Shivpurwa

As per Census 2011, Shivpurwa village has a total population of 1,335 people, consisting of 689 males and 646 females. The village has 286 households and a sex ratio of 937 females per 1,000 males. There are 206 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 708 literate and 627 illiterate residents. Additionally, 430 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 165 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Shivpurwa

Shivpurwa is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 5-10 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Joba, while the nearest airport is Satna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 76.4 km.
